All-In-One Washer Dryer

All-in-one washer dryers decrease the number of laundry appliances you need to keep at home. They also save time and energy because they can transport your laundry from washing to drying without requiring you to shift loads between two machines.

Most combo units are ventless and require just a single 120-volt household outlet instead of a dedicated gas or electrical connection for a separate dryer. They are equipped with a variety of features and cycles, including automatic detergent dispensers.

Convenience

Combination dryers and washers are ideal for households with small spaces because they eliminate the necessity of separating laundry appliances. They may have a lower capacity than standalone units but their ability to wash and dry a load in one cycle makes it an appealing choice for those with small spaces. They consume less energy than standalone washers/dryers and can help you save money on utility bills.

Ventless and vented models are the two most popular models. Ventless models require a vent to run out of the wall, usually in the same room in which the washer is. They also tend have higher drying capacity than models that are not vented.

Ventless, or non-vented, combination washer dryers use a process called condensation drying to eliminate moisture from the clothes. They don't require a dryer vent, and are often installed in the same room as the washer. Because they don't let humid, hot air into the room, these units are ideal for rooms that have limited ventilation.
